Asset Tagging in Kenya: A Comprehensive Breakdown

Utilizing asset tagging systems in Kenya is steadily becoming vital for organizations of all sizes . This procedure entails attaching unique labels or identifiers to equipment, allowing for accurate management of their condition and control. Key benefits include improved accountability, reduced loss , and simplified workflows . Boosting Asset Visibility: The Rise of Asset Tagging in Kenya

Kenya's expanding economy is witnessing a significant surge in the implementation of asset tagging solutions. Previously, tracking equipment and inventory was a a time-consuming process, often relying on spreadsheets. However, the requirement of improved asset monitoring – particularly within sectors like logistics and agriculture – has spurred the widespread uptake of advanced asset tagging systems. This trend delivers a number of benefits, like reduced loss, improved operational performance, and improved accuracy in asset valuation. Asset tags, ranging from QR codes and RFID devices, are now being utilized to track everything from machinery to components, enabling businesses to secure a clear view of their property.

  • Minimizes asset loss
  • Enhances operational efficiency
  • Provides better financial insights

Asset Management Best Practices: Kenya's Adoption of Tagging

To boost accountability and effectiveness in governmental property management, Kenya is actively utilizing asset identification technologies. This vital change entails fixing unique identifiers – often employing barcode – to different assets. The resulting information supports improved tracking of location, maintenance records, and overall value, finally reinforcing financial governance and minimizing loss.
